BTW, just as a little follow-up and to make it more tractor related. /forums/images/graemlins/grin.gif Where we had off loaded the tank was even close to where it needed to be, but we knew worse case scenario we could make a temp hook up. The tractor couldn't pick the whole tank up, (he helped me take the blade off and put the cutter on for extra weight so that we could try that while we waited on the wrecker /forums/images/graemlins/laugh.gif). I could pick the one end up though. I ended up dragging the tank into place on Janaury 2nd. Was also able to drag the old tank to a location so they could pick it up - they waited until the ground refroze. Another situation that developed out of this whole scenario - I ended up having to replace the water heater. It had started leaking just a little bit. Glad I was trying to relight it when I noticed. I hadn't checked it as it was only 5 years old. Nothing like an emergency water heater replacement after you've already done the tasks you had planned for the day. (Couldn't get the cover off the relight either, once I discovered it was leaking I decided to cut my losses. /forums/images/graemlins/crazy.gif)
